US energy stocks slip as oil price drop continues to 6-year low
The oil price drop to 6-year low and rise in crude inventories are taking a toll on energy companies. This put more pressure on trading in energy stocks on Wall Street. The market forecast of interest rate hike by Fed also further dampened the sentiment.

Venezuela's currency against US dollar tumbles 737%
Venezuela's currency, the Bolivar, against the US dollar is falling by the day. The bolivar fell over 700% in just 12 months indicating the worst economy conditions, increasing inflation rate, drop in oil export revenues. The country is heading towards default on its debt repayment.

Toshiba wants new blood to lead its board; Interim president stays
Japanese major Toshiba Corp has reshuffled its board by inducting more outside directors, while retaining interim President on permanent basis. Toshiba has conveyed an extraordinary shareholders' meeting to seek approval for the board restructuring.
